Bela Padilla on breakup with Norman Bay: ‘Somewhere down the line, we’ll become friends again’
Bela Padilla opened up on her breakup with long-term boyfriend Norman Bay on “Fast Talk with Boy Abunda” on Wednesday.
According to Bela, they "reached the end of our chapter" and that the breakup was amicable.
She noted that Norman even visited her after they broke up, when he flew to the Philippines for a few weeks for a holiday.
“We spoke naman,” the actress said.
She added that they are “at a stage where we’re allowing ourselves to grow first.”
“I feel like somewhere down the line, we’ll become friends again. Ganun naman ako eh, I don’t harbor bad feelings with exes.”
Tito Boy then noted that Bela had posted a bouquet on Valentine’s Day.
Bela clarified that she is currently not in a relationship, adding, “But there is somebody that’s been making me smile. ‘Yun na lang muna.”
Bela and Norman were together for four years.
In an interview on Karen Davila’s YouTube channel, Bela said the reason for their breakup was her moving back to the Philippines. Norman did not want to move here as he also has a successful career in London.
